Understanding the Components of Load Charts

Before tackling the NCCCO practice load chart exam, it’s essential to break down what

load charts actually include. Here are some key elements you’ll commonly find:

Load Radius

The horizontal distance from the center of the crane’s rotation to the center of the load.

This distance affects the crane’s lifting capacity — the farther out the load, the less weight

the crane can safely lift.

Boom Length and Angle

Load charts specify capacities based on different boom lengths and the angles at which

the boom is positioned. Longer booms or flatter angles reduce lifting capacity.

Load Weight

The actual weight of the load being lifted, which must always be within the crane’s rated

capacity for the given boom length and radius.

Counterweights

Counterweights balance the crane and increase lifting capacity. Load charts often list

capacities with specific counterweight configurations.

Crane Configuration

Different setups such as lattice booms, telescopic booms, or jib attachments change the

crane’s load chart capacities.

Recognizing these components and how they interact is vital when answering questions

on the NCCCO practice load chart exam.

Common Challenges and How to Overcome Them

Many candidates find the load chart section challenging because it combines technical

knowledge with applied math under pressure. Here’s how to tackle some common

hurdles:

Complex Terminology

Crane load charts use industry-specific terms and abbreviations. Creating a glossary or

flashcards of these terms can help reinforce your understanding.

Time Management

During the exam, time can be limited. Practice pacing yourself with timed quizzes to build

speed without sacrificing accuracy.

Visual Interpretation

Load charts are often presented in tabular or graphical formats. Training your eye to

quickly extract relevant data from these visuals is essential.

Applying Theory to Practice

Sometimes, understanding the theory isn’t enough—you need to apply it to real-world

scenarios. If possible, observe crane operations or use simulation software to see how

load chart data affects actual lifts.

The Importance of the NCCCO Practice Load Chart Exam

Load charts are technical diagrams that provide crucial information about a crane’s lifting

capacities under various configurations and conditions. They outline maximum load limits,

boom lengths, radius, angles, and other operational parameters. The NCCCO practice load

chart exam evaluates a candidate’s proficiency in deciphering these charts, ensuring they

can make informed decisions on site.

Misinterpretation of load charts can lead to catastrophic failures, including crane

collapses, property damage, and loss of life. Consequently, the NCCCO emphasizes this

exam as a measure of both knowledge and safety awareness. It not only tests theoretical

understanding but also the practical application of load chart data in real-world scenarios.

Core Components of the Practice Load Chart Exam

The NCCCO practice load chart exam typically includes questions that assess several

critical areas:

Load Capacity Interpretation: Understanding maximum allowable loads at

1.

different boom lengths and angles.

Radius Calculations: Determining the horizontal distance from the crane’s center

2.

of rotation to the load’s center of gravity.

Configuration Variations: Assessing how changes in boom length, counterweight,

3.

or jib affect load limits.

Environmental Factors: Considering wind, ground conditions, and other external

4.

elements impacting crane stability.

These components ensure candidates are well-rounded in their knowledge, preparing

them to handle the dynamic variables encountered during operations.

Challenges and Considerations in Preparing for the Load Chart

Exam

Despite its benefits, some candidates find the NCCCO practice load chart exam

challenging due to the technical nature of load charts and the precision required.

Complexity of Load Charts

Load charts vary by crane model and manufacturer, each with unique layouts and data

presentation. Candidates must become familiar with multiple chart types and understand

how to interpret them quickly and accurately.

Mathematical Rigor

The exam often involves calculations related to radius, load weight, and configuration

adjustments. Operators with limited math skills may find this aspect demanding,

underscoring the need for thorough preparation.

Time Constraints

Practice exams simulate timed conditions, which can increase stress levels. Managing

time effectively is crucial to complete all questions without sacrificing accuracy.
